OK so today my carb count is 131grams. and its all fruit veggies and whole grains and lentils. here is the menu

breakfast Premier Protein

snack 6 oz strawberry chobani

lunch salad made with kale,spinach,arugula, and chard, with steamed lentils,1 egg, 1/4 slice avocado and raspberry vinaigrette.

snack 1/2 cup of black bean Soup with 5 no sodium tortilla chips *note* 5

dinner trader joes spinach pita pizza made with olive oil,garlic, spinach/w a side of steamed kale,and bok choy.

snack 1 tbsp of garlic hummus 1/2 pita bread, 1/4 cup pineapple, 1/4 cup strawberry's, and 1/4 cup soy Beans shelled. total numbers for today.

cal 1127

carbs 131

protein 76

fat 37

Fiber 30

i just love eating clean

that's correct no meat, I am going vegetarian

You are welcome. I think us "slow" losers shy away for many reasons, sad, but true. I think there are more of us than we probably realize. My surgeon reminded me of the stats, 70% of excess weight in the first 12-18 months and it could take up to 2 years to reach goal. I hope it doesn't take me two years , but it is still faster than my year of nutritional planning and working out with a 15lb loss that I gained back on vacation. I am so thankful for my sleeve whether it takes me 12-24 months to reach goal!
